Obituary for Art Versteeg

Art  Versteeg
Art Versteeg ~ At Wingham & District Hospital on Wednesday, January 31, 2018, Mr. Arthur James Versteeg of Howick Township, went to be with his Lord, in his 53rd year.

Beloved husband of Louise (VanderBorgh) Versteeg. Dear father of Alesia and John Taylor of Edmonton, Alberta, Justin and Kelly Versteeg of Harriston, Lori and Sam DeGroot of Sanborn, Iowa, and Trish, Mike, and Lydia, all at home. Opa to Trevor, Cody, Lili, and Ivan. Son of Catharina Versteeg of Fordwich, and brother of Carrie and Ralph Groen of Milgrove, Irene and Robert Reinink of Dugald, Manitoba, Martha and George Schellingerhoud of Aurora, Abe and Debbie Versteeg, and Eric and Hazel Versteeg, all of Howick Township. Son-in-law of Herman and Marj VanderBorgh of Gowanstown, and brother-in-law of Don VanderBorgh of Molesworth, Debbie Greydanus of Gowanstown, and Dave and Julia VanderBorgh of Molesworth.

Predeceased by his father Jakob Versteeg, sister Betty Versteeg, and brother-in-law Bert Greydanus.

The Lord Willing, the visitation will be held on Monday, February 5 from 2:00 to 4:00 and 6:00 to 8:00 p.m. and the funeral service will be held on Tuesday, February 6 at 11 a.m. Both visitation and service will be held at the Palmerston Christian Reformed Church. Interment in Lakelet Cemetery.
Memorial donations to Word & Deed Ministries would be appreciated, and may be made through the Eaton Funeral Home, Listowel.
